How do I know if my roof needs to be replaced or just repaired?
Signs that your roof in Smith Creek may need replacement include: shingles that are curling, cracking or missing in multiple areas; granules accumulating in gutters (indicates worn shingles); daylight visible through the attic; widespread moss or algae growth; a roof that is 20+ years old. If the damage is isolated to one area, repair may be sufficient. A licensed roofer in Smith Creek can assess whether repair or replacement is the more cost-effective solution.

Can a new roof be installed in winter in Smith Creek?
Roofing in winter is possible but comes with challenges in Smith Creek. Cold temperatures can make asphalt shingles brittle and harder to seal properly. Most manufacturers require installation above 4°C for standard shingles. In winter, roofers use special cold-weather adhesives and may need to store materials indoors before installation. How do I choose a roofing contractor in Smith Creek?
To choose the best roofer in Smith Creek: verify they hold a valid contractor licence for your province; confirm they carry general liability and workers compensation insurance; ask for references from recent projects in Smith Creek or nearby; get a detailed written quote including materials, labour, disposal and warranty terms; and compare at least 3 contractors. Avoid paying more than 10–15% upfront. A reputable roofer will pull the permit and provide a written workmanship warranty.
What does a roofing warranty cover in Canada?
Roofing warranties in Canada come in two types. The manufacturer's material warranty covers defects in the shingles or membrane — typically 25–50 years for quality products, but often prorated. The contractor's workmanship warranty covers installation errors — usually 2–10 years depending on the roofer. In Smith Creek, ask your contractor to provide both warranties in writing before work begins. Some manufacturers offer enhanced warranties when you use a certified installer.
